Embark on a memorable Island Hopping Day Trip to Hornby Island with Tales on Trails, departing from scenic Fanny Bay, British Columbia. This boat tour offers an incredible escape into the natural beauty of Canada's coastal waters. As you cruise between islands, you’ll enjoy expansive views of rugged shorelines, crystal-clear waters, and vibrant marine life that highlight the region’s unique charm. On Hornby Island, renowned for its artistic community and pristine beaches, there’s plenty of time to explore quiet coves, stroll along sandy shores, or visit charming local spots. This private adventure provides a personalized experience, allowing you to savor the tranquility that only an intimate boat tour can offer. Whether it’s spotting seals lounging on rocks, photographing colourful driftwood formations, or simply soaking in the fresh ocean air, this trip delivers a refreshing way to connect with nature. The knowledgeable guides from Tales on Trails enrich the journey with insights into local ecology and history, making it an educational outing as well. Ideal for families, couples, or solo travelers looking for a relaxed day on the water, this island hopping tour shows off the best of British Columbia’s coastal islands and promises an unforgettable outdoor adventure.

History

Hornby Island has a rich Indigenous heritage and was historically an important fishing and trade area for local First Nations.

About Tales on Trails

Tales on Trails is an adventure tour operator based in Victoria, British Columbia. It offers guided day trips and multi‑day tours across Vancouver Island, focusing on waterfalls, old‑growth forests, beaches, wildlife viewing, caves, and cultural sites. Tours include single‑day options such as the Mid Island Day Trip, Victoria Goldstream, Waterfall, Skywalk and Historic Castle and Garden, and themed experiences for families and nature lovers. Multi‑day itineraries include the Pacific Marine Circle Route, a four‑day Victoria to Tofino journey, and overnight West Coast passages that highlight Port Renfrew, the Jurassic Grove, and West Coast beaches.

Guides lead hikes to waterfalls and ancient Western Red Cedars, explore tide pools, and facilitate wildlife viewing for whales, sea lions, and salmon. Optional experiences include cave expeditions, visits to wildlife rescue centers, a yurt overnight stay, and a float plane return from Tofino. The Spring Break Waterfall, Museum, Aquarium trip includes complimentary passes to the Royal BC Museum and the Shaw Centre for the Salish Sea Aquarium. The Victoria Ferry Connector and Forest Walking Tours offer shorter options for families, pet‑friendly walks, and visitors connecting via ferry.

Tales on Trails emphasizes small‑group experiences, local knowledge, and curated routes across Vancouver Island’s ecosystems.
